By default, all deformers in CINEMA 4D are represented in the viewport by a cyan cage. The cage and
its handles represents how the deformation effect will be applied to the object.
You can modify the deformers cage in several ways. The two most common ways are by dragging
its handles in the viewport or by adjusting its values in the Attribute manager. The following sections
on the individual deformer objects give more detail on the relevance of this cage and how it can be
adjusted.
You can restrict a deformer’s inuence using vertex maps and polygon selections.
Activate UVW mapping before you deform objects. This will prevent textures from ‘slipping’.
Bend
This deformer bends an object. Drag the orange handle on the deformer’s top surface to change the
bend interactively in the viewport.
